Bob Henderson is a renowned outdoor enthusiast and author, celebrated for his extensive knowledge of wilderness travel and adventure. With a career spanning decades, he has penned numerous works that delve into the beauty of nature and the art of exploration. His writings often reflect his passion for outdoor education and his commitment to fostering a deeper connection between people and the natural world.
